- The distance between Antalaha/ Antsirabat, Madagascar and Cold Bay, Alaska, Usa is approximately 14,717 km or 9,145 mi.
- To reach Antalaha/ Antsirabat in this distance one would set out from Cold Bay, Alaska bearing 314.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Antalaha/ Antsirabat bearing 204.8° or SSW .
- Antalaha/ Antsirabat has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Cold Bay, Alaska has a subpolar oceanic climate (Cfc).
- Antalaha/ Antsirabat is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Cold Bay, Alaska is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
- The average temperature is 20.3 °C (36.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.5 °C (15.3°F) less in Antalaha/ Antsirabat.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1461.7 mm (57.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1461.7 l/m² (35.87 US gal/ft²) or 14,617,000 l/ha (1,562,654 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 36.2° higher in Antalaha/ Antsirabat than in Cold Bay, Alaska.
